中新网酒泉5月23日电 (记者 马帅莎)5月23日,神舟二十三号载人飞行任务新闻发布会在酒泉卫星发射中心举行。记者从会上获悉,神舟二十三号乘组中有一名航天员将执行一年期飞行任务。
中国载人航天工程新闻发言人张静波在会上表示,安排一名航天员执行一年期在轨驻留试验,绝非是时间上将两个半年期任务简单累加。为期一年的太空驻留,一是将实施我国首个太空人体研究计划,全面获取航天员更长期飞行数据,丰富任务实施经验;二是将验证航天员长期飞行健康保障能力,完善在轨医疗与防护体系;三是将为科学项目和相关技术验证提供更长期的延续性研究机遇。
谈及哪位航天员将执行此项任务,张静波说,根据计划安排,后续会根据具体在轨任务执行情况予以确定。(完)
